Output 857519e0a715baf5fc5b58ad8211e469428e9beb2b6fff8e3c20256044fa4d01:0

value
605275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e687e5156717af4b45fd33995b6378cc1ec52da OP_EQUAL
address
3DDQF3Zw451KWFYQE9fvW5qhtChT6Kqimj
transaction
857519e0a715baf5fc5b58ad8211e469428e9beb2b6fff8e3c20256044fa4d01
spent
true